Output 7585ece5c8300034a23b0d6ea4fd22a99f317f76d6a4c46dfa0f8768ef633da1:0

value
7927959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22d7ca8ecf029a918b7e158efaaf6ec04e6170cf OP_EQUAL
address
34sFQWCjqjH5k6UEm1L517tKAKAMXkrAG5
transaction
7585ece5c8300034a23b0d6ea4fd22a99f317f76d6a4c46dfa0f8768ef633da1
spent
true